Italian Ambassador, Armando Varricchio, visited the Bay Area in May, for the second time since he presented his credentials as Italy’s ambassador to the United States last year. During his five days in California, Ambassador Varricchio managed to meet and talk to some expats who represent Italy’s best talents in America.
He took some time to visit the flourishing Napa Valley, he met with the California Governor, Jerry Brown; the President of the University of California, Janet Napolitano, and with San Francisco Mayor, Ed Lee. Therefore, he was at Stanford University where he talked about Italy and Europe, visited the Tesla headquarter, and joined an event at Lamborghini.
